Saab cars made from 1994 have an immobilizer system that is based on key codes. A new transponder is required for the addition of an extra key, and special programming. This is usually done by the dealer using a Tech2 diagnostic tool.

The problem is that this can be extremely expensive. This is why you should always keep a spare key in your possession.

Transponder key

The transponder key comes with an electronic chip that sends a signal to the car when it is inserted into the ignition. The car will then check the signal to determine whether it is identical to the one on the key. If the signals are in sync it will open and start. This is a great method to stop auto theft and keep your car secure from thieves.

Transponder keys are an increasingly popular feature for cars, but they're not as safe as traditional keys made of metal. The metal part of the traditional key can be easily copied and cut, but the transponder is protected by an electronic chip that safeguards it. The chip has a unique code that is programmed into the car's computers to identify it.

When a Saab key fob is used the car recognizes it and allows it to turn on. The car will only recognize the key fob if it is equipped with an unmodified chip and has been programmed to match. Otherwise, the car would reject the key and not start.

Jump-starting the battery

Most people keep an assortment of tools in their trunks to start a car in case of emergency, however it might not be a good option for vehicles with newer technology. These cars are equipped with a variety of computers and digital devices which communicate with one another. A surge in voltage when a battery is hooked up to another battery could fry these components, rendering your car unable to drive.

Connect the cables to the vehicle that is working. Let it run for two minutes. Attach the red clip to the positive terminal of the good battery (it will have "POS" or "+" on it). Attach the other end of the black cable to a clean, unpainted metal surface beneath the damaged vehicle's hood. An engine block is a good choice. Do not connect the black cable to the negative terminal of the dead battery as this could cause an ignition source that ignites gasoline in the engine bay.

Once the cables are connected, turn on the disabled vehicle and allow it to run for around five minutes before you disconnect the cables in reverse order.
